No Switch version exists, and it’s unlikely. The game’s engine doesn’t play nice with the system, and porting would probably require a full rebuild. Shame, because couch co-op on Switch is golden. For now, it’s PC/PS/Xbox or nothing. If you’re into story-driven co-op, 'Brothers: A Tale of Two Sons' (single-player but feels co-op) is on Switch and equally emotional.

BioShock on the Switch? Oh, this takes me back! I remember booting up the remastered collection on my PS4 years ago, but when I heard it came to Switch, I had to double-check. Yep, the entire 'BioShock: The Collection' is available digitally and physically for Switch owners. It includes 'BioShock 1', 'BioShock 2', and 'BioShock Infinite', plus all their DLCs. Honestly, playing 'Infinite' handheld feels surreal—Columbia’s skyline on a tiny screen somehow works. Performance-wise, it holds up surprisingly well. Docked mode looks crisp, though you might notice some texture pop-in in handheld. The joy-con controls take getting used to, especially for precision aiming, but gyro aiming helps. If you’re a fan of atmospheric storytelling or just want to revisit Rapture on the go, it’s a solid pickup. I’ve lost count of how many times I’ve replayed the ‘Would You Kindly’ twist.
